The Unique Logistics Challenges of Pet Products
Before diving into the evaluation, it’s essential to understand why pet supplies are a logistical category unto themselves. This isn’t about shipping phone cases or apparel.
Product Diversity & Size: Inventory can range from tiny flea collars and sachets of treats to 40-pound bags of dog food, bulky cat trees, and fragile aquarium ornaments. A logistics partner must handle this extreme SKU variance efficiently.
Seasonality & Trends: Subscription boxes, holiday-themed items (Halloween costumes, Christmas stockings), and viral social media pet products can cause sudden, massive spikes in order volume.
Sensitivity & Compliance: Many items are consumable (food, supplements) or sensitive (probiotics, certain medications), requiring strict climate control, proper rotation (FIFO – First-In, First-Out), and adherence to regulatory standards.
High Return Potential: Incorrect sizing for apparel/harnesses or simple pet pickiness with toys and beds leads to a higher-than-average return rate, necessitating a robust and thoughtful returns process.
A generic fulfillment service often stumbles under these conditions. Success requires a partner built for complexity, scalability, and brand-centric care.

Q2: My pet products vary massively in size and weight. How is pricing structured?
A2: Pricing is typically multi-faceted, encompassing storage costs (per pallet, shelf, or bin), picking/packing fees (per order), and shipping costs (based on the parcel’s final dimensional weight and destination). A good provider like Fulfillant will offer a transparent, tailored quote that accounts for your specific SKU mix.
Q3: Can I create and fulfill custom pet subscription boxes through a 3PL?
A3: Absolutely. This is called “kitting.” Providers like Fulfillant can store individual components (a toy, a bag of treats, a grooming item) and then assemble them into a single subscription box SKU on demand, applying custom branding before shipping.

Q5: How do returns for pet products work with a dropship fulfillment service?
A5: A comprehensive service includes a returns management program. The 3PL receives the return at their warehouse, inspects the item (if applicable), updates your inventory, and can either dispose of it, return it to stock, or ship it to a different address based on pre-set rules you configure.

Q7: How do I sync my online store inventory to prevent overselling?
A7: Through direct platform integrations (e.g., with Shopify). When an order is placed on your store, it is instantly sent to the 3PL’s system. As soon as they scan and fulfill it, an update is sent back to your store, deducting that quantity from your available inventory in near real-time.
